    I was finally able to find some information that would be beneficial for this as well! Thank you $(you need an account to see links) for sending some stuff my way for the Blood Type Diet:



    Key Notes:

    According to D'Adamo, the foods you consume undergo a chemical reaction with your blood type. Adhering to a diet tailored to your blood type can enhance the efficiency of food digestion, leading to weight loss, increased energy, and a reduced risk of disease.



    ** Warning please see a doctor when discussing blood types or blood type diets- We are not doctors, only they can help you tailor your needs! **

    Following this thread, this is what I do:

    Meats (As my source of protein, chicken and red grass fed beef almost daily)
    Veggies (I dont follow a trend, but I follow my intuition and always choose different colours)
    Fruits (Bananas, mostly).
    Nuts (On my workout days to put some extra calories on)
    Beans (Hard to digest. But still I consume quite a lot)
    Seeds (Same as beans)
    Seafood (White fish often)
    Grains (Rice, oats, quinoa...)
    Drinks (I never drink juices. Only water / infusions or zero calorie sodas. Rarely, alcohol).
    Fats/Oils (I like those. I eat lot of butter. Avocado oil. Olive oil. Coconut. Keep in mind that different oils have different smoke points and this matters a lot when cooking)
    Dairy (Butter again. Yogurt)
    Milks (I never go for fake milks anymore. Everyone should do some research about it. If I drink milk, I preffer animal sources... And I used to be vegan!)
    Cheese (Sometimes)
    Spices/Herbs (A lot! They do the trick, as I often eat similar meals, spices and herbs, give such a different taste to each one of them)
